Where does “nertystning” come from?

nertystning (Swedish) comes from Swedish nertysta, from Swedish tysta, from Swedish tyst, from Old Swedish þyster, from Proto-Germanic þusiþaz, from Proto-Germanic þusjaną, from Proto-Indo-European tewh₂- — to swell; to crowd; to be strong.
